#!/usr/bin/env bash
# The Heroku Python Buildpack. This script accepts parameters for a build
# directory, a cache directory, and a directory for app environment variables.
# Warning: there are a few hacks in this script to accommodate excellent builds
# on Heroku. No guarantee for external compatibility is made. However,
# everything should work fine outside of the Heroku environment, if the
# environment is setup correctly.
# Usage:
#
# $ bin/compile <build-dir> <cache-dir> <env-path>
# Fail fast and fail hard.
set -eo pipefail
# Standard Library.
export BPLOG_PREFIX="buildpack.python"
export BUILDPACK_LOG_FILE=${BUILDPACK_LOG_FILE:-/dev/null}
[ "$BUILDPACK_XTRACE" ] && set -o xtrace
# Prepend proper path for virtualenv hackery. This will be deprecated soon.
export PATH=:/usr/local/bin:$PATH
# Paths.
BIN_DIR=$(cd $(dirname $0); pwd) # absolute path
ROOT_DIR=$(dirname $BIN_DIR)
BUILD_DIR=$1
CACHE_DIR=$2
ENV_DIR=$3
# Python defaults
DEFAULT_PYTHON_VERSION="python-2.7.13"
DEFAULT_PYTHON_STACK="cedar-14"
PYTHON_EXE="/app/.heroku/python/bin/python"
PIP_VERSION="9.0.1"
# Common Problem Warnings
export WARNINGS_LOG=$(mktemp)
export RECOMMENDED_PYTHON_VERSION=$DEFAULT_PYTHON_VERSION
# Setup vendored tools and pip-pop (pip-diff)
export PATH=$PATH:$ROOT_DIR/vendor/:$ROOT_DIR/vendor/pip-pop
# Support Anvil Build_IDs
[ ! "$SLUG_ID" ] && SLUG_ID="defaultslug"
[ ! "$REQUEST_ID" ] && REQUEST_ID=$SLUG_ID
[ ! "$STACK" ] && STACK=$DEFAULT_PYTHON_STACK
# Sanitizing environment variables.
unset GIT_DIR PYTHONHOME PYTHONPATH
unset RECEIVE_DATA RUN_KEY BUILD_INFO DEPLOY LOG_TOKEN
unset CYTOKINE_LOG_FILE GEM_PATH
# Syntax sugar.
source $BIN_DIR/utils
# Import collection of warnings.
source $BIN_DIR/warnings
# we need to put a bunch of symlinks in there later
mkdir -p /app/.heroku
# Set up outputs under new context
PROFILE_PATH="$BUILD_DIR/.profile.d/python.sh"
EXPORT_PATH="$BIN_DIR/../export"
GUNICORN_PROFILE_PATH="$BUILD_DIR/.profile.d/python.gunicorn.sh"
WEB_CONCURRENCY_PROFILE_PATH="$BUILD_DIR/.profile.d/WEB_CONCURRENCY.sh"
# We'll need to send these statics to other scripts we `source`.
export BUILD_DIR CACHE_DIR BIN_DIR PROFILE_PATH EXPORT_PATH
# Prepend proper environment variables for Python use.
export PATH=/app/.heroku/python/bin:/app/.heroku/vendor/bin:$PATH
export PYTHONUNBUFFERED=1
export LANG=en_US.UTF-8
export C_INCLUDE_PATH=/app/.heroku/vendor/include:/app/.heroku/python/include:$C_INCLUDE_PATH
export CPLUS_INCLUDE_PATH=/app/.heroku/vendor/include:/app/.heroku/python/include:$CPLUS_INCLUDE_PATH
export LIBRARY_PATH=/app/.heroku/vendor/lib:/app/.heroku/python/lib:$LIBRARY_PATH
export LD_LIBRARY_PATH=/app/.heroku/vendor/lib:/app/.heroku/python/lib:$LD_LIBRARY_PATH
export PKG_CONFIG_PATH=/app/.heroku/vendor/lib/pkg-config:/app/.heroku/python/lib/pkg-config:$PKG_CONFIG_PATH
# Switch to the repo's context.
cd $BUILD_DIR
# Warn for lack of Procfile.
if [[ ! -f Procfile ]]; then
puts-warn 'Warning: Your application is missing a Procfile. This file tells Heroku how to run your application.'
puts-warn 'Learn more: https://devcenter.heroku.com/articles/procfile'
fi
# Prepare the cache.
mkdir -p $CACHE_DIR
# Restore old artifacts from the cache.
mkdir -p .heroku
cp -R $CACHE_DIR/.heroku/python .heroku/ &> /dev/null || true
cp -R $CACHE_DIR/.heroku/python-stack .heroku/ &> /dev/null || true
cp -R $CACHE_DIR/.heroku/python-version .heroku/ &> /dev/null || true
cp -R $CACHE_DIR/.heroku/vendor .heroku/ &> /dev/null || true
if [[ -d $CACHE_DIR/.heroku/src ]]; then
cp -R $CACHE_DIR/.heroku/src .heroku/ &> /dev/null || true
fi
# Experimental pre_compile hook.
source $BIN_DIR/steps/hooks/pre_compile
# Sticky runtimes.
if [ -f $CACHE_DIR/.heroku/python-version ]; then
DEFAULT_PYTHON_VERSION=$(cat $CACHE_DIR/.heroku/python-version)
fi
# Stack fallback for non-declared caches.
if [ -f $CACHE_DIR/.heroku/python-stack ]; then
CACHED_PYTHON_STACK=$(cat $CACHE_DIR/.heroku/python-stack)
else
CACHED_PYTHON_STACK=$STACK
fi
# Pipenv Python version support.
source $BIN_DIR/steps/pipenv-python-version
# If no runtime given, assume default version.
if [ ! -f runtime.txt ]; then
echo $DEFAULT_PYTHON_VERSION > runtime.txt
fi
mkdir -p $(dirname $PROFILE_PATH)
mkdir -p /app/.heroku/src
if [[ $BUILD_DIR != '/app' ]]; then
# python expects to reside in /app, so set up symlinks
# we will not remove these later so subsequent buildpacks can still invoke it
ln -nsf $BUILD_DIR/.heroku/python /app/.heroku/python
ln -nsf $BUILD_DIR/.heroku/vendor /app/.heroku/vendor
# Note: .heroku/src is copied in later.
fi
# Install Python.
let start=$(nowms)
source $BIN_DIR/steps/python
mtime "python.install.time" "${start}"
# Pipenv support.
source $BIN_DIR/steps/pipenv
# If no requirements.txt file given, assume `setup.py develop` is intended.
if [ ! -f requirements.txt ] && [ ! -f Pipfile ]; then
echo "-e ." > requirements.txt
fi
# Fix egg-links.
source $BIN_DIR/steps/eggpath-fix
# Mercurial support.
source $BIN_DIR/steps/mercurial
# Pylibmc support.
source $BIN_DIR/steps/pylibmc
# Libffi support.
source $BIN_DIR/steps/cryptography
# Support for Geo libraries.
sub-env $BIN_DIR/steps/geo-libs
# GDAL support.
source $BIN_DIR/steps/gdal
# Install dependencies with Pip (where the magic happens).
let start=$(nowms)
source $BIN_DIR/steps/pip-install
mtime "pip.install.time" "${start}"
# Uninstall removed dependencies with Pip.
let start=$(nowms)
source $BIN_DIR/steps/pip-uninstall
mtime "pip.uninstall.time" "${start}"
# Support for NLTK corpora.
let start=$(nowms)
sub-env $BIN_DIR/steps/nltk
mtime "nltk.download.time" "${start}"
# Support for pip install -e.
# In CI, $BUILD_DIR is /app.
if [[ ! "$BUILD_DIR" == "/app" ]]; then
rm -fr $BUILD_DIR/.heroku/src
deep-cp /app/.heroku/src $BUILD_DIR/.heroku/src
fi
# Django collectstatic support.
let start=$(nowms)
sub-env $BIN_DIR/steps/collectstatic
mtime "collectstatic.time" "${start}"
# Create .profile script for application runtime environment variables.
set-env PATH '$HOME/.heroku/python/bin:$PATH'
set-env PYTHONUNBUFFERED true
set-env PYTHONHOME /app/.heroku/python
set-env LIBRARY_PATH '/app/.heroku/vendor/lib:/app/.heroku/python/lib:$LIBRARY_PATH'
set-env LD_LIBRARY_PATH '/app/.heroku/vendor/lib:/app/.heroku/python/lib:$LD_LIBRARY_PATH'
set-default-env LANG en_US.UTF-8
set-default-env PYTHONHASHSEED random
set-default-env PYTHONPATH /app/
# Install sane-default script for $WEB_CONCURRENCY and $FORWARDED_ALLOW_IPS.
cp $ROOT_DIR/vendor/WEB_CONCURRENCY.sh $WEB_CONCURRENCY_PROFILE_PATH
cp $ROOT_DIR/vendor/python.gunicorn.sh $GUNICORN_PROFILE_PATH
# Experimental post_compile hook.
source $BIN_DIR/steps/hooks/post_compile
# Fix egg-links, again.
source $BIN_DIR/steps/eggpath-fix2
# Store new artifacts in cache.
rm -rf $CACHE_DIR/.heroku/python
rm -rf $CACHE_DIR/.heroku/python-version
rm -rf $CACHE_DIR/.heroku/python-stack
rm -rf $CACHE_DIR/.heroku/vendor
rm -rf $CACHE_DIR/.heroku/src
mkdir -p $CACHE_DIR/.heroku
cp -R .heroku/python $CACHE_DIR/.heroku/
cp -R .heroku/python-version $CACHE_DIR/.heroku/
cp -R .heroku/python-stack $CACHE_DIR/.heroku/ &> /dev/null || true
cp -R .heroku/vendor $CACHE_DIR/.heroku/ &> /dev/null || true
if [[ -d .heroku/src ]]; then
cp -R .heroku/src $CACHE_DIR/.heroku/ &> /dev/null || true
fi
# Measure the size of the Python installation.
mmeasure 'python.size' "$(measure-size)"
